Title Digital procurement towards new performance frontiers: a systematic literature review and future research fronts
ID_Doc 75374
Authors Jain, P; Gupta, AK
Title Digital procurement towards new performance frontiers: a systematic literature review and future research fronts
Year 2024
Published Journal Of Global Operations And Strategic Sourcing, 17, 1
Abstract Purpose As digital procurement continues to transform heavily as a value center and create new business models by linking businesses with a web of external partners, the full path to achieving such an all-encompassing thing is unknown. Thus, the study aims to explore the research gap through an exhaustive bibliometric and systematic literature review on the Digital procurement theme in the supply chain domain.Design/methodology/approach This study is a qualitative and quantitative analysis of this field, using performance analysis and science mapping to examine 583 articles published from 2002 to 2021.Findings A systematic literature review indicated core topics on "sustainable or green procurement" and "emerging landscape of technology" in the field of study.Research limitations/implications Though the Scopus database used for the analysis is the largest, it may not have complete coverage of all published articles in the field of study; thus, this study is a representation of only a sample rather than its entire population.Originality/value Outcome is based on the review of the past 20 years' contribution on the topic starting from 2002 to 2021.
